New CNC Machine Factory in Riyadh to Support Saudi Vision 2030

Egypt-based CNC machine manufacturer Simplex has acquired $13 million, led by Saudi Arabia’s National Industrial Development Centre (NIDC), to establish its first advanced manufacturing facility in Riyadh. This investment marks a significant milestone in Saudi Arabia’s industrial localization efforts, aligning with the Kingdom’s Vision 2030 strategy.

“We are grateful for the significant support provided by the Saudi National Industrial Development Centre,” said Eng. Ahmed Shaaban, Chairman of Simplex.
“This factory is a major step toward expanding our global reach and increasing exports of CNC machines while strengthening Saudi Arabia’s position as a regional industrial hub.”

A State-of-the-Art Manufacturing Hub

The new 20,000-square-meter factory in Riyadh will focus on producing advanced CNC machines to meet growing regional and global demand. The facility is expected to begin operations in Q1 2026, creating new jobs and enhancing Saudi Arabia’s industrial capabilities.

Simplex signed a memorandum of understanding (MoU) with NIDC, solidifying its commitment to the Saudi market. The agreement was formalized during a signing ceremony attended by:

  • Eng. Ahmed Shaaban, Chairman, Simplex CNC
  • Eng. Khalil ibn Salamah, Vice Minister of Industry and Mineral Resources, Saudi Arabia
  • Key officials from both Saudi Arabia and Simplex

Simplex is expanding Global Presence beyond Saudi

Mohamed Mansour, Co-Founder & Chief Commercial Officer at Simplex, highlighted Saudi Arabia’s strategic importance:

“Saudi Arabia is a key market and a gateway for global exports. This factory enables us to meet rising demand, strengthen our international presence, and develop innovative products for multiple industries.”

Driving Saudi Vision 2030

This expansion aligns with Saudi Vision 2030, focusing on economic diversification, industrial innovation, and non-oil exports. By establishing local production, Simplex will:

  • Reduce reliance on imported CNC machines
  • Boost Saudi Arabia’s industrial sector
  • Enhance job creation and skills development

Since its founding in 2013, Simplex has supplied CNC machines to over 50 industries across 21 countries, making it a trusted name in advanced manufacturing solutions.

“Our vision is to be a global leader in CNC manufacturing,” Mansour added.
“This new facility is a vital step in achieving that goal while contributing to Saudi Arabia’s industrial transformation.”
